Q: Is 300,012,233 a Prime Number?
A: No, 300,012,233 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 300012233 can be evenly divided by 1 47 6,383,239 and 300,012,233, with no remainder.
Since 300,012,233 cannot be divided by just 1 and 300,012,233, it is not a prime number.
